I met with the Executive Director of the Federation of Calgary Communities. We have asked that the FCC raise concerns with regards to the engagement process/model that the City is using. The FCC will focus on asking the City to revamp the process as Council has directed. We have provided two specific examples for them to use in their communication—the sale and development of Richmond Green, and the derailed engagement process for GamePLAN.
We have run out of time to settle our hall insurance claim. We have reached the two-year mark and filed a Statement of Claim with the Courts for over $600,000. Unfortunately, an engineering report shows that there were pre-existing deficiencies with the floor system, so the insurer did not budge much off of their original offer. As we do not have the funds to sue them in court, we have settled for less than $100,000. At least now we can move forward with the engineering process and apply for grants to help us rebuild. This has been a long and arduous process, and we are not there yet. Canada Lands will be making some changes to the CFB West Master Outline Plan in order to preserve some buildings and reduce the size of the business area. We will continue to share updates via our e-newsletter and Facebook page.
